A Cheltenham Pedersen in London (No. 12)

It's about 7,900km from Cheltenham to London to the Lamassu, the winged bull that guarded the entrance to the Nergal Gate of Nineveh in Iraq. Destroyed by Daesh in 2015, it has been recreated in Trafalgar Square by Michael Rakowitz out of Iraqi date syrup cans.
